  Actin disassembly: How to contract without motors?

Harasimov, K., & Schuh, M. (2018). Actin disassembly: How to contract without motors? Current Biology, 28(6), R275-R277. doi:10.1016/j.cub.2018.02.019.

 Abstract: Contractile actin networks take on various functions in cells. How disordered actin networks contract is still poorly understood. A recent study proposes a contractile mechanism that is driven by actin disassembly and required to prevent chromosome losses in starfish oocytes
